The WSJ reported paying $ 130 thousand the porn star for concealing ties with trump.
Lawyer Trump Organization has agreed to pay ex-porn star $ 130 thousand for concealing an intimate relationship with Donald trump. The White house said the reports were “categorically refuted” even before the election.


Stephanie Clifford. In pornography, known under the name Stormy Daniels

Lawyer Donald trump for a month before the US presidential elections in November 2016 agreed to pay a former pornographic actress Stephanie Clifford $ 130 thousand under the agreement to disclose information about the alleged intimate relationship with trump. This writes the Wall Street Journal, citing familiar with the situation sources.

Trump’s lawyer Michael Cohen, one of the leading lawyers of the Trump Organization, have agreed on the payment by counsel of a porn actress Stephanie Clifford in October 2016 . The newspaper’s sources say that in intimate relationships trump and Clifford joined in July 2006 Golf tournament at lake Tahoe in California. Trump is married to Melania trump in 2005.

Clifford, in private conversations said that the meeting with trump was held after their meeting in the tournament, according to the Wall Street Journal.

“This is an old circulating earlier messages that were strongly refuted before the election,” the WSJ reported White house official. He refused to answer questions about the agreement with Clifford. Michael Cohen, in his commentary did not discuss the payment of $ 130 million, but said: “President trump again strongly denies any such relationship with Ms. Daniels [alias Clifford]”. Cohen added that this “false story consistently denied by all parties since 2011”.

The Wall Street Journal citing sources reported that in the fall of 2016 Clifford was in talks with ABC about a possible participation in the program “Good morning America” that she was going to talk about a possible relationship with trump. In the end, Clifford refused to participate in the transmission.

The article also mentioned that the company is the publisher of the tabloid National Enquirer paid the former Playboy model Karen Mcdougal $ 150 million for a story about possible ties with trump, at that time a candidate for the Republican presidential nomination. In the end, the tabloid story that was never published. Officially, the publisher of the National Enquirer explained the disbursement of the honorarium for Mcdougal column about fitness and appearance on the cover of magazines.

Clifford did not answer the questions WSJ. Her lawyer, Keith Davidson, refused to comment on the work with their clients. The WSJ sources say that the money was sent to bill Davidson in the City National Bank in Los Angeles.
